China/Korea Thriller, TIK TOK Gets An Explosive First Trailer
Press is officially underway for the upcoming release of the new thriller, Tik Tok, which opens on July 15 in China. The film spreads its wings a bit for director Li Jun and the shared partnership between production banners, Beijing Hairun and South Korea-based Dhuta Co. Ltd who are reportedly on track to produce several more pictures together after this.
The film sees Wallace Chung (Monster Hunt, Three) in a villain role opposite Lee Jung-Jae (Assassination, Big Match) in a story that pits cop against suspect in the wake of a bombing during a soccer game between China and South Korea. Following a tightly-scheduled shoot last year, the first trailer is finally out and about along with new artwork, and from the looks of it, companies Hairun and Dhuta have a pretty good thing going.
